This is the 40,000th year of the Empire's dominance over the Galaxy. The glory of the Great Expedition has long been buried in the dust of history. Su Yu has transmigrated here, opening his eyes to the ruins of a planet in front of him, utterly bewildered. On this planet, there are war machines that stretch for thousands of kilometers, now broken to the extreme, alien beasts whose roars can shatter mountains and rivers, and radiation alien beasts whose mere movement causes further destruction to the surrounding environment— There is everything here, except hope. Whether willingly or not, Su Yu struggled to survive for three years and finally inevitably contracted radiation sickness, seemingly about to become one of the despairing. Until his Profession Panel, capable of infinite job transfers, finally activated. "Ding!" "Detected that the host has met the prerequisites; do you want to take the profession of [Mechanic]?" "Completing this job will allow you to gain profession experience through daily maintenance, recovery, and assembly of mechanical creations, leveling up the profession, and with each upgrade, you receive an enhancement amplification of your physical attributes..." Looking at the pile of broken gun parts in his repair room, an unprecedented light lit up in Su Yu's eyes! Years later, at the core of the Empire, at the highest point of the Terra world, Su Yu, the Mechanic from Ruins Star, Ghost Shadow Blade of Dead Silence Wilderness, Initiator of the Giant God Soldier Project's Restart, Governor of the Shattered Star Region, Master of Mechanical Ascension, Supreme Throne of the Forging World, looked at the torrent of steel gathering below and commanded with a wave of his hand! [Our goal is to make the (second) (crossed out) Empire great again!]

What are the job opportunities for cartoon drawing in India?
The job opportunities for cartoon drawing in India are diverse. You might get hired by media houses for creating comics or by design firms for visual storytelling. Freelancing is also a viable option, where you can take on projects from different clients across the country.

How has the India Recruiting Scam Story affected job seekers in India?
The India Recruiting Scam Story has had a very negative impact on job seekers. Many have lost their hard - earned money to these scams. Some have also wasted a lot of time and energy chasing after fake job offers. This has led to a sense of distrust among job seekers towards recruitment agencies and even some employers. It has also made it more difficult for genuine job seekers to find legitimate opportunities as they are constantly on guard against being scammed.

How can stories for teaching ancient India history engage students?
Stories can engage students if they are presented in an interactive way. For the story of the Vedic period, teachers can ask students to role - play different characters like the sages or the kings. This way, students get involved in the story and are more likely to remember the historical details associated with it.
